Meiosis and mitosis are confused because iof the similarities in both the types of division.

The similarities between mitosis and meiosis is that in both types of cell division -

  • the cells divide to form daughter cells
  • DNA is replicated to form an extra set
  • centrioles move to the opposite end of the cell and form spindle fibers between them
  • the cell membrane, nucleolus and nuclear envelope all all break down
  • the chromosomes line up in the center of the cell and each spindle fiber is attached to the center of the chromosome by their centromere
  • the spindle fibres bring the chromatids to the opposite end of the cell
  • in the ending phases of mitosis and meiosis the nuclear envelopes each contain half the amount of chromosome
  • both the processes are a type of reproduction

What term should not be confused with Mitosis?

Meiosis should not be confused with Mitosis. Mitosis is a type of cell division that results in two identical daughter cells, while meiosis is a type of cell division that results in four haploid daughter cells with genetic variation.
